The City of Twin Falls is seeking two candidates to fill a current and future vacancy on the Historic Preservation Commission.
The Commission promotes the educational, cultural, economic and general welfare of Twin Falls residents through the identification, evaluation, designation, and protection of buildings, sites, areas, structures, and objects that reflect the City’s heritage.
Professional training or experience in architecture, history, architectural history, urban planning, archaeology, engineering, conservation, landscape architecture, law, or other historic preservation related disciplines is preferred. But all interested residents are encouraged to apply.
The Commission meets regularly on the first and third Monday of each month at 12 p.m. for approximately one hour. There could be some additional meetings required during the month. There are some evening and weekend activities that you may be asked to attend.
